About This Event

WECIL hosts an accessible community gathering in Bristol to discuss hate crime, discrimination and belonging. The event aims to amplify disabled voices and takes place on 21 September 2026. Tickets are listed as free.

WECIL hosts a free, accessible gathering on hate crime, discrimination and belonging, amplifying disabled voices and driving change.

Join us at WECIL for a fun and supportive Community Gathering to discuss Hate Crime, Discrimination and Belonging to increase trust, confidence and facilitate strategies for change. This will be a safe and welcoming space to discuss experiences of Hate Crime as well as the key challenges and barriers relating to research and reporting.The event will be attended by:

- Disabled people with lived experience

- Local decision-makers and policymakers

- Disability rights organisations and support groups

- Researchers and academics studying disability, poverty and social policy.

Outcomes:

- To hear and amplify the voices of disabled people with lived experience.

- To connect and network with both the WECIL team, other disabled people and professional people.

- Share insights and experiences with policy makers and local leaders.

- To move forward by collaboratively action planning, advocating and plan systemic change.

Access and accessibility:

The event is being held at The Vassall Centre in Fishponds, Bristol, which is a pioneering, fully accessible, barrier-free single-storey building featuringlevel access. There is dedicated disabled parking, accessible toilets including a Changing Places toilet with hoist and the building has hearing loops throughout.
